BTW, for those who don't know the FPS metric display is activated by getting to the console (should be able to do this with a Ctrl+Alt+` {left of the 1 key on most keyboards, just ask if you can't get into the console or otherwise}) and then typing "com_showFPS 1"). ...I think that's right, right?
